The statement, reported by baseball columnist Bob Nightingale (often referred to simply as "Nightingale"), suggests that Nolan Arenado may be willing to waive his full no-trade clause for essentially any team that the St. Louis Cardinals are able to negotiate with.
This indicates a significant shift in his previous stance.

Actually , his proclamation may not be as outlandish as it sounds . If one thinks about it , a very poor team even with Cardinals paying for a good chunk of his remaining $$ would most likely not be interested in Arenado so the teams that are possibilites are either playoff teams right now or quite likely a team knocking on the door and hope that Arenado can get them into a wildcard spot , etc.

We will stay tuned. The GM meetings began today in Las Vegas and Bloom will get more clarity on what other GM's have interest in Arenado.
Wouldn't surprise me that once a team shows interest that a deal could be forthcoming sooner rather than later. Bloom has other players to move this winter.
